Использование отдельных проектов TFS для контроля исходного кода и отслеживания рабочих элементов - это хорошо? - PullRequest
1 голос
/ 08 октября 2008

У меня есть клиент, который использует один проект TFS только для контроля исходного кода и теперь хочет управлять рабочими элементами в совершенно другом проекте TFS, используя другой шаблон процесса, и намеревается связать наборы изменений с рабочими элементами в проектах TFS.

Я знаю, что это возможно в TFS, но не знаю, какие ограничения или проблемы возникают в этой конфигурации. например, создание сводок, отчетов и т. д.

Я бы предпочел разветвлять код в новый проект TFS и управлять кодом и рабочими элементами вместе в одном проекте, но нужно знать, как складывается описанный выше метод.

Ответы [ 3 ]

1 голос
/ 09 октября 2008

Это сработает - мне иногда приходилось связывать проверки с рабочими элементами из других проектов. Я не заметил каких-либо проблем с отчетами и т. П., В которых говорилось, что это слишком сложное соглашение с небольшой выгодой.

0 голосов
/ 16 сентября 2014

Мы использовали эту модель, чтобы позволить нам иметь отдельные проекты, но с одной и той же веткой исходного кода. Некоторое время это работало, но как только мы начали проявлять больше приключений с ветвями, модель сломалась. Поэтому, как отметили другие, нет никаких причин, почему технически вы не можете сделать это, это не стандартно.

0 голосов
/ 09 октября 2008

Похоже, странная установка для меня. Несмотря на то, что он работает, TFS предназначен для регистрации и рабочих элементов в одном командном проекте, поэтому вы не сможете в полной мере воспользоваться преимуществами функций TFS. Знает ли клиент, что он может изменить шаблон процесса существующего командного проекта, или выполнить то, что вы говорите, и выполнить ветвление, или даже просто переместить источник в новый командный проект.

...